The Musicians Fellowship was held at Saron’s Café, GHS Colony on 1st June, 2024. The Fellowship is an initiative brought forth by TaFMA District Partner, Wokha which is also a part of TaFMA’s open house, ‘Musicians Converge Wokha’.

Addressing the musicians, Libemo Jami, YRO Government of Nagaland, underscored their significance as an invaluable resource and asset.

During the event, Achen Yanthan showcased his original composition “Beautiful,” while Chenithung Kithan delivered a rendition of Steve Perry’s renowned track “I Stand Alone,” followed by significant insights by Yanpothung Ezung.

Mhademo Ennio, TaFMA’s District Partner urged musicians to unite under Musicians Converge Wokha to collectively excel, surpass, and explore new horizons.
